The relaxed atmosphere makes it pleasant even during busier periods, but arrive early on weekends to secure good spots and parking during peak season.","q":"What is the best time to visit Yamami Beach?"},{"a":"Yamami Beach is accessible from Nagoya by both car and public transportation. By car, it's approximately 60-75 minutes via the Chita Peninsula Road. For public transport, take the Meitetsu train from Nagoya to Kowa Station on the Kowa Line, then catch a local bus or taxi to the beach. During summer months, special beach shuttle buses may operate from nearby stations. Rental cars offer the most flexibility for exploring multiple beaches on the Chita Peninsula. Parking is available near the beach, though it fills quickly on summer weekends.","q":"How can I get to Yamami Beach from Nagoya?"},{"a":"Yamami Beach and the surrounding Minamichita area offer various dining options, from beach shacks serving casual snacks to local seafood restaurants featuring fresh catches from Ise Bay.
